Fair-Weather Cooperation
An interaction wherein individuals cooperate with others only when it is to their immediate benefit or when conditions are favorable.
Intimate Friendships
Deep and close relationships characterized by a high level of trust, emotional support, and understanding, often developing over time.
Middle Childhood
A developmental stage that ranges approximately from 6 to 12 years of age, characterized by increased physical, cognitive, and social abilities.
Peer Group
A social group of people, typically of similar age, background, or social status, who influence each other's behaviors and attitudes.
